Functional annotations
There are 1 annotated functions for this event
PMID: 14722076
This event
The proteoglycans aggrecan, versican, neurocan, and brevican bind hyaluronan through their N-terminal G1 domains, and other extracellular matrix proteins through the C-type lectin repeat in their C-terminal G3 domains. Here the authors identify tenascin-C as a ligand for the lectins of all these proteoglycans and map the binding site on the tenascin molecule to fibronectin type III repeats, which corresponds to the proteoglycan lectin-binding site on tenascin-R. In the G3 domain, the C-type lectin is flanked by two epidermal growth factor (EGF) repeats and a complement regulatory protein-like motif. In aggrecan, the EGF repeats are subject to alternative splicing (each repeat is encoded by a cassette exon: EGF-like 1 is encoded by HsaEX0001787, and EGF-like 2 is encoded by HsaEX0001788). To investigate if these flanking modules affect the C-type lectin ligand interactions, the authors produced recombinant proteins corresponding to aggrecan G3 splice variants. The G3 variant proteins containing the C-type lectin showed different affinities for various ligands, including tenascin-C, tenascin-R, fibulin-1, and fibulin-2. The presence of an EGF motif enhanced the affinity of interaction, and in particular the splice variant containing both EGF motifs had significantly higher affinity for ligands, such as tenascin-R and fibulin-2.
